Ticket #— Floor 9 Opening Prep, Brindlemoor House

Hi facilities folks, Floor 9 opens to staff next Monday and we need a few things squared away before then. Lift access is live, but the two side doors by the kitchenette are still on the old lock config — please reprogram them before Friday. Also, signage for the quiet rooms hasn't arrived, so pop up the temporary printed ones for now. Until the badge readers sync, the interim door code for Floor 9 is below.

door code, bajop-bajog: bdg-DSWAC-43621

Telemetry frames are large and repetitive, so compression cuts bandwidth roughly 70%. Chat frames are small; compression adds CPU and memory per connection with little gain, and context takeover makes memory use unpredictable at our connection counts. Don't flip compression flags per-client — it's a gateway-level setting. Benchmarks from the Saltmarsh load tests, including memory-per-connection numbers and the decision record, are written up on the internal engineering page.

runbook for badug-kadup: https://confluence.zemvarlabs.internal/projects/browse/display/projects/bd1b

# Soft deletes: orders table

Orders in Merrowby are never hard-deleted. The cleanup worker flips `deleted_at` and archives rows nightly. Before running the worker manually, verify you are pointed at staging, not production. The worker needs the archive service credential in its environment, so add this line to the env file first:

vault entry, yahif-yajep: COURIER_KEY29=b802bdf8034096b65a51c6ba5abe2

☐ Canteen orientation (new starter, day one). The Bramwick Hall canteen on level 1 is shared with our neighbours at Ostrey Logic, so remind the new starter that the seating area past the yellow pillars belongs to them and discussions of client work should stay on our side. Lunch service runs 11:30–14:00; trays go back to the rail by the west doors. The connecting door between the two sides stays locked outside service hours, and staff passing through should use the code below.

staff pass of kawip-hawef = bdg-QLP-2